MVC小型商务网站实例(1)--项目简介

开篇有益

.net 两年多了现在才开博觉得有点晚。

本开源项目当前使用框架如下:

前台表现:Asp.net MVC 2

数据库:SQL2008

数据持久层:ADO.Net Entity Framework 4.0

依赖注入容器:Castle Windsor

开发工具:VS2010

 

开源项目地址:http://ngshop.codeplex.com/

  

项目结构图:

 

MvcShop.Core是项目架构的类库

MvcShop.Extensions是项目扩展类库可适用于任何项目

MvcShop.Models是项目的数据实体和数据工厂类库

MvcShop.MVC是项目的Controller和辅助类

MvcShop.Web是前台页面

 

要创建数据库,请打开setup文件夹下的SouthShop.sql用查询分析器生成数据库 , 或打开 SouthShop.edmx 模型视图,在视图显示页面中,点击鼠标右键,选择 “根据模型生成数据库”可以得到创建数据库的SQL,然后修改相关Config中的数据库连接字符串就可以了(MvcShop.Web下的Web.config和MvcShop.Models下的App.config)。

 

我对代码管理平台不是很熟悉。所以代码发布得比较乱。

有兴趣的朋友下载后可按项目结构图进行整理。

我美工方面比较差,界面不太好,不过代码是不错的,项目有些功能还末完成,欢迎广大技术好友下载源码,一起探讨、拍砖哈!

我更多的希望能通过技术好友,学到更多...

 


posted on 2011-03-17 21:04  Ω元素  阅读(1485)  评论(3编辑  收藏  举报

导航